Are You Overlooking These Critical Aspects of Startup Financial Modeling?

 If you're running a startup, you already know that financial planning isn't just about crunching numbers—it’s about survival. Yet, many founders overlook key elements of startup financial modeling, leading to flawed projections, cash flow issues, and unrealistic growth plans. Are you making the same mistakes? Let’s break down the critical aspects you might be missing. 1. Are Your Revenue Projections Realistic? It’s tempting to dream big and predict skyrocketing revenues, but wishful thinking won’t impress investors or keep your business afloat. Your startup financial modeling should be based on: Market research and actual customer demand Realistic pricing strategies Competitive analysis and industry benchmarks Instead of assuming exponential growth, consider a more conservative approach with different scenarios—best-case, worst-case, and expected-case projections. 2. What Are the Biggest Mistakes to Avoid in Financial Modeling?

 Financial modeling is like the blueprint of a business's financial future. Whether you're a startup founder or an investor, making errors in financial modeling services can lead to disastrous decisions. So, what are the biggest mistakes you need to dodge? Let's break them down. 1. Overcomplicating the Model A financial model should be easy to understand and interpret. If it looks like a maze of endless sheets, formulas, and macros, you're doing it wrong. Keep formulas simple and transparent. Avoid unnecessary complexities that make the model difficult to update. Ensure that anyone (even a non-financial person) can grasp the key takeaways. A well-structured financial model should tell a clear story—not leave people scratching their heads. 2. Ignoring Realistic Assumptions Garbage in, garbage out—that’s how financial modeling works. If your assumptions aren’t grounded in reality, the model is worthless.
